Katrina Leskanich, born in Topeka, Kansas, is a pop and new wave icon. As frontwoman of Katrina & The Waves, she achieved global fame with "Walking on Sunshine" and the 1997 Eurovision-winning "Love Shine a Light." Known for her powerful vocals, she received a Grammy nomination and released the album "Hearts, Loves & Babys" in 2020, and the single "I Couldn't Live Without Your Love" in 2024.

The Christians, formed in Liverpool in 1985, are a soul-influenced pop band known for rich vocal harmonies and socially conscious lyrics. Their debut album sold over a million copies, and "Colour" reached UK No. 1. Popular songs include "Ideal World" and "Words." They have released albums such as "Speed of Life," "We," "Sings & Strings," "Goes With Saying," and singles like "Naz Don't Cry," "Tanera Days," and "The Only Dreamer." They collaborated on the charity single "Ferry 'Cross The Mersey." Lead singer Garry Christian is noted for his distinctive soulful voice.
